在这个数字化时代,无论是手机还是电脑,用户界面(UI)的设计都至关重要。一款优秀的UI设计不仅美观,而且要能适应不同的平台和设备。下面,我将分享一些实用的跨平台UI设计技巧,帮助你在手机和电脑上轻松打造出既美观又实用的界面。
了解不同平台的特性
首先,我们需要了解手机和电脑在UI设计上的差异。以下是一些关键点:
手机UI设计
- 触摸操作:手机UI设计需要考虑触摸屏的特性,按钮和控件应足够大,便于操作。
- 屏幕尺寸:手机屏幕尺寸相对较小,因此内容需要简洁明了。
- 单手操作:设计时应考虑用户单手操作的可能性。
电脑UI设计
- 鼠标操作:电脑UI设计主要针对鼠标操作,因此细节和交互元素可以更复杂。
- 屏幕尺寸:电脑屏幕通常更大,可以展示更多内容。
- 多任务处理:设计时应考虑到用户可能同时打开多个应用程序或窗口。
设计原则
一致性
- 视觉元素:保持颜色、字体、图标等视觉元素的一致性。
- 交互逻辑:确保不同平台上的交互逻辑一致。
简洁性
- 内容精简:避免在界面中放置过多无关信息。
- 布局清晰:保持界面布局清晰,便于用户快速找到所需内容。
可访问性
- 字体大小:确保字体大小足够大,便于阅读。
- 色彩对比:使用高对比度的颜色组合,提高可读性。
工具与资源
设计工具
- Sketch:适用于Mac的矢量图形设计工具,适合移动端UI设计。
- Adobe XD:支持跨平台设计的工具,适用于Web、移动和桌面应用程序。
- Figma:基于浏览器的协作设计工具,支持多人实时协作。
设计资源
- 图标库:Flaticon、Iconfinder等提供大量免费和付费图标。
- 配色方案:Adobe Color、Coolors等提供配色工具和方案。
实战技巧
1. 使用响应式设计
响应式设计能够根据不同设备的屏幕尺寸自动调整界面布局。使用媒体查询(Media Queries)是实现响应式设计的关键。
@media (max-width: 768px) {
/* 手机端样式 */
}
@media (min-width: 769px) and (max-width: 1024px) {
/* 平板端样式 */
}
@media (min-width: 1025px) {
/* 电脑端样式 */
}
2. 考虑触摸操作
在手机UI设计中,确保按钮和控件足够大,便于用户触摸操作。例如,按钮的直径至少为44x44像素。
3. 优化加载速度
无论是手机还是电脑,用户都希望快速加载应用程序。优化图片、使用CDN、减少HTTP请求等方法可以提高加载速度。
4. 测试与反馈
在设计和开发过程中,不断进行测试和收集用户反馈,以便及时调整和优化UI设计。
通过以上技巧,你可以在手机和电脑上轻松掌握跨平台UI设计。记住,优秀的UI设计不仅美观,还要实用,真正为用户提供良好的使用体验。
